Robert Parker's Wine Advocate
Crafted from vines planted in Aÿ, Dizy, Hautvillers and Champillon (59%) and 41% in Avize and Oiry, the NV Extra-Brut Cuvée No. 742 Dégorgement Tardif, matured for 96 months on the lees under cork, reveals a subtle, complex bouquet of exotic fruits, honey, beeswax, ripe orchard fruits, chamomile and herbs. Medium to full-bodied, sappy and textured, it has a vinous, fleshy core of fruit, racy acids and a saline, delicate mid-palate, leading to a long, mineral and ethereal finish. Disgorged in April 2023 with 0.5 grams per liter dosage. This is a Champagne for gastronomy.

Winemaking
Blend of wines from the 2014 vintage with 21% reserve wines. Second fermentation in bottle with a minimum ageing of 96 months and a final dosage of 0.5 g/l (Extra Brut).
